Frequently Asked Questions about Short-term Bristol Park Apartments

What is the Cheapest Short-term apartment in Bristol Park?

Currently the most affordable Short-term Apartment in Bristol Park is at Lincoln at Wolfchase listed at $1,064.

How much is the average rent for a Short-term Bristol Park Apartment?

The average rent for a Short-term Apartment in Bristol Park is $2,007.

What is the largest Short-term Bristol Park Apartment for rent?

Today's Short-term apartment with the most square footage in Bristol Park is a 1,506 square feet unit starting from $1,343 at Lakeland Town Square.

What is the average size for Bristol Park Short-term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Short-term rental in Bristol Park is currently at 604 sq ft.

Battling the Butts: Your Guide to the Reality of Smoke-Free Renting

Written by: Andrea Lee Negroni, JD

While many apartment buildings are “no smoking” properties, it’s hard to know exactly how many. In 2017, the National Apartment Association reported more than half of rental properties had smoke free policies.
